You may recall that last year Argentina suddenly announced that puma would not be exportable, although it was perfectly legal to hunt them in various provinces. The ban took both hunters and operators by surprise. It now seems that was only a prelude to this newly extended ban covering all other indigenous species. As with the ban on exporting puma, this latest move was also a surprise to outfitters as they tried to export their clients' trophies. Dozens of hunters awaiting shipments from Argentina will not be able to get any of their indigenous trophies now. The ban, of course, does not affect the export of introduced species, such as red stag and blackbuck.
